This episode compares the stories of Adam Alsahli, the radical
Islamist who attacked the Corpus Christi Naval Air Station, with
stories of two Incels, Armando Hernandez, Jr., who shot couples
in an Arizona mall, and an unidentified teen who took a machete
to women in a Canadian erotic spa. Incels are men who are
‘Involuntarily Celibate’, and hate women for rejecting them - not
wanting to be their girlfriend or have sex with them. These stories
pose the question: are we using the word ’terrorist’ too loosely?

Adam Alsahli, a 20-year-old Syrian-born U.S. citizen, with social
media posts supporting terrorists, tried to speed through a
security gate at the Naval Air Station and opened fire. Armando
Hernandez, Jr., a 20-year-old Incel, wanted to injure couples so
they’d feel the pain he feels because of being shunned by women.
The prosecutor called him a “self-pitying terrorist.” A 17-year-old
Incel, had been charged with murder and attempted murder, but
for the first time, Canadian authorities have charged an Incel with
terrorism.

After hearing these stories, you’ll come to understand how Incels
are different from Radical Islamists, and how they are similar -
and you can decide if Incels who attack should be charged with
terrorism.
